Magdalene Fox was born in 1836 in , Montgomery, OH, the child of Daniel Booker Fox And Rebecca Keister. In 1850, Magdalene Fox resided in Duchouquet, Auglaize, Ohio, USA. In 1870, Magdalene Fox resided in Duchouquet, Auglaize, Ohio, USA. Magdalene Fox married Eli P Burden, James Madison Shaw, and had children including Cora Burden, George Shaw, Harriet B Hattie Shaw, Mary Elizabeth Burden, Samuel Burden. Magdalene Fox passed away in 1880 in ,,,USA.
